add two functions for CA Info Packet and Metadata Packet
Change-Id: Ibbfb799f07d715b964e829f66b193d7d36717317
diff --git a/src/ca-module.hpp b/src/ca-module.hpp
index 80aaac0..7e9c7e6 100644
--- a/src/ca-module.hpp
+++ b/src/ca-module.hpp
@@ -71,6 +71,12 @@
dataContentFromJson(const JsonSection& jsonSection);
PUBLIC_WITH_TESTS_ELSE_PRIVATE:
+ shared_ptr<Data>
+ generateCaConfigMetaData();
+
+ shared_ptr<Data>
+ generateCaConfigData();
+
void
onInfo(const Interest& request);
@@ -96,22 +102,6 @@
registerPrefix();
PUBLIC_WITH_TESTS_ELSE_PRIVATE:
- JsonSection
- genProbeResponseJson(const Name& identifier,
- const std::string& m_probe,
- const JsonSection& parameterJson);
-
- JsonSection
- genInfoResponseJson();
-
- JsonSection
- genNewResponseJson(const std::string& ecdhKey, const std::string& salt,
- const CertificateRequest& request, const std::list<std::string>& challenges);
-
- JsonSection
- genChallengeResponseJson(const CertificateRequest& request);
-
-PUBLIC_WITH_TESTS_ELSE_PRIVATE:
Face& m_face;
CaConfig m_config;
unique_ptr<CaStorage> m_storage;